1. The Council discussed the nomination process for the City's Boards and Commissions.
Jennifer Walters, City Secretary, reviewed the nomination process for the boards and
commissions. Council would be presented with a notebook containing current terms that were
expiring, member responses for re-nomination, attendance, new applications and a preference
chart for applicants. She asked the council to take the weeks during the summer break to contact
their nominations which would be presented to Council at the July 17th meeting.

1. The Council held the first of two public hearings to consider the voluntary annexation
and service plan for two sites. The first site was approximately 7.85 acres and the second site
was approximately 1.54 acres, totaling approximately 9.39 acres. The sites to be annexed were
generally located on the north side of Spencer Road between Woodrow Lane and Brinker Road.
The sites were within a tract of land legally described as Municipal Utility Addition, Lot 1,
Block 2. (A07-0002, Denton Municipal Electric Spencer Complex Annexation)
Brian Lockley, Interim Director of Planning and Development, stated that this was a voluntary
annexation for a portion of the Denton Municipal Electric Spencer Complex property and
associated right-of way.
The Mayor opened the public hearing.
No one spoke during the public hearing.
The Mayor closed the public hearing.
No action was required on this item at this time.
2. The Council held the first of two public hearings to consider the voluntary annexation
and service plan for approximately 127.9662 acres. The property to be annexed was generally
located in the northwestern area of the City of Denton's Extraterritorial Jurisdiction (ETJ) at the
northwest corner of I-35N and the future Loop 288 extension. (A07-0001, Westview Commercial
Annexation)
Brian Lockley, Interim Director of Planning and Development, stated that this was a voluntary
annexation for the Westview Commercial property and associated right-of way. There were no
future plans for the property, outside the future right-of way for the Loop 288 extension. The
notice of annexation had met all state mandated requirements.

Mayor McNeill asked if there would be an advantage to include state right-of way in the
annexation.
City Manager Campbell stated that it would assist police officers with the enforcement of traffic
aws m t e area.
Mayor McNeill asked why it had been left out of the annexation.
Lockley replied that the property was state right-of way and not VVestview Commercial property.
The State would have to provide permission for the City to annex the right-of way.
Deputy Mayor Pro Tem Mulroy indicated that unless the annexation was on a critical path, staff
should check with TxDot to include the right-of way in the annexation.
The Mayor opened the public hearing.
No one spoke during the public hearing.
The Mayor closed the public hearing.
No action was needed on this item at this time.
